Ця стаття — для тих, хто хоче зробити сервіс, де люди беруть машини на кілька годин чи днів. Тут усе пояснено дуже просто, як для друга. Я розповім, що треба зробити в сервісі, як працюють машини, тарифи, оплати та чому Laravel — хороший вибір.
Про що ця стаття
Тут пояснюю, як створити сайт або додаток для каршерінгу на Laravel. Пишу коротко і зрозуміло. Немає складних слів. По кроках: що треба в системі, як показувати машини, як рахувати гроші і як робити все безпечно.
Як працює платформа — простими словами
Уявіть: у вас є база машин, ціни і кнопка «Орендувати». Коли людина натискає, система перевіряє, чи машина вільна, рахує суму і просить оплатити. Після оплати машина стає заброньована, і людина може її взяти.
Laravel — це інструмент для розробників. Він допомагає зробити сайт швидко і чисто. Ви не бачитимете усі технічні деталі — тільки потрібні кнопки і сторінки.
Керування машинами — що потрібно
Кожна машина має простий набір даних. Це потрібні речі, які бачить користувач:
-
назва (марка, модель)
-
рік випуску
-
тип пального (бензин, дизель, електро, гібрид)
-
пробіг (скільки вже проїхала)
-
чи є кондиціонер, крісло для дитини, GPS
-
статус: доступна , заброньована , на ремонті
Адмін може легко додати машину, змінити опис або поставити статус «на ремонті». Користувач бачить тільки те, що йому потрібно, і вибирає.
Пошук і фільтри — щоб було просто знайти машину
Коли людина заходить — вона хоче знайти швидко. Тому зробіть прості фільтри:
-
вибір марки чи моделі
-
тип пального
-
потрібні опції (кондиціонер, дитяче крісло)
-
час оренди (години або дні)
Дайте можливість сортувати: дешевші спочатку або найближчі до місця користувача.
Тарифи — простими словами
Ціни повинні бути зрозумілими. Поясніть людям, скільки і за що вони платять.
| Що | Що це означає |
| Погодинний тариф | Платите за кожну годину |
| Добовий тариф | Платите за цілий день |
| Додаткові опції | GPS, дитяче крісло, страховка — окремо |
| Знижки | Для постійних клієнтів або акцій |
| Крайня ціна | Сума, яку бачить користувач перед оплатою |
Рахунок робиться так: базова ціна × час + опції + можливі штрафи (якщо треба). Всі цифри показуйте заздалегідь — щоб не було сюрпризів.
Оплати — як зробити простіше і безпечніше
Користувачі хочуть платити швидко і без страху. Підключіть відомі платіжні сервіси (наприклад Stripe або PayPal). Laravel добре з ними працює.
Що важливо:
-
показати суму перед оплатою;
-
зберігати тільки те, що потрібно (не зберігайте повні дані карток у відкритому вигляді);
-
підтверджувати оплату і відправляти чек на e-mail;
-
мати можливість повернути гроші, якщо замовлення скасували.
Безпека даних і доступів — прості правила
Безпека — це не тільки складні слова. Це прості речі, які треба робити завжди:
-
Паролі зберігати безпечно (не в простому тексті).
-
Вхід через e-mail або телефон з підтвердженням.
-
Розділити права: адміністратор бачить більше, ніж звичайний користувач.
-
Шифрування для платіжних даних та важливої інформації.
-
Резервні копії бази даних — на випадок проблем.
Laravel має інструменти, які допомагають це робити просто.
Тестування — перевіряємо, щоб усе працювало
Перед запуском треба перевірити все. Робіть прості тести:
-
чи додається машина;
-
чи можна забронювати і оплатити;
-
чи змінюється статус машини після броні;
-
чи приходить повідомлення користувачу.
Краще знайти помилки зараз, ніж після запуску.
Підтримка і моніторинг — після запуску
Після старту платформа потребує догляду:
-
дивіться лог сервера — чи нема помилок;
-
стежте за платежами і звітами;
-
відповідайте на питання користувачів швидко;
-
ремонтуйте машини, коли треба, і змінюйте їх статус.
Добре мати просту панель для адміністраторів, де все видно.
Поради по дизайну — щоб людям було зручно
-
Робіть інтерфейс простим. Одна мета на сторінці — напр., «Орендувати».
-
На мобільному все повинно працювати швидко. Більшість людей замовляє через телефон.
-
Фото машини має бути чітким, короткий опис і ціна.
-
Додайте кнопку «Зателефонувати» або «Пишіть у чат» — це дає довіру.
Тренди 2025 — що зараз важливо
-
Більше електромобілів у парку. Людям важливо де зарядити.
-
Мобільний додаток повинен бути простим і швидким.
-
Підписки або пакети поїздок (наприклад, 10 годин за зниженою ціною).
-
Аналітика : дивіться, які машини популярні, коли люди беруть авто, і підлаштовуйте тарифи.
Короткий покроковий план (щоб почати)
-
Зробіть базу даних для машин, тарифів і оплат.
-
Створіть сторінку з переліком машин і фільтрами.
-
Додайте сторінку бронювання і оплату.
-
Налаштуйте повідомлення користувачеві (e-mail чи SMS).
-
Перевірте все тестами.
-
Запустіть і стежте за роботою.
Висновок
Платформа для каршерінгу на Laravel дозволяє швидко і просто створити сучасний сервіс оренди автомобілів. Вона допомагає легко керувати машинами, тарифами і оплатами, робить все зрозумілим для користувачів і безпечним для їхніх даних. Завдяки Laravel розробка проходить швидко, а платформа залишається гнучкою та готовою до розвитку.
Якщо ви плануєте свій каршерінг, саме така платформа стане надійним і зручним рішенням для вашого бізнесу.